SUPREME POWER EQUIPMENT L Share Price

Supreme Power Equipment Limited (SPEL) was incorporated as 'Supreme Power Equipment Private Limited' vide Certificate of Incorporation dated June 21, 2005, with the Registrar of Companies, Chennai. Further, the Company was converted into a Public Limited Company & name of the Company was changed to Supreme Power Equipment Limited dated September 18 2023.

The Company is currently engaged into the areas of manufacturing, up-gradation, and refurbishment of transformers including Power Transformer, Generator Transformer, Windmill Transformer, Distribution Transformer, Isolation Transformer, Solar Transformer, Energy Efficient Transformer, Converter and Rectifier Transformer. To carry out the business operations, the Company require various raw materials including Core - CRGO Silicon Steel Lamination; Copper Wires and Strips; Insulating Oil; On Load Tap Changing Gear (OLTC) and MS Fabricated Tank.

Power transformers are vital components in electrical power systems, serving several crucial functions to ensure transmission, and distribution of electrical energy. Generator transformers are vital components in power generation plants, ensuring that electricity generated by various sources is efficiently transformed and transmitted to electrical grid. Windmill transformers generated by wind turbines is efficiently transformed and integrated into the electrical grid, contributing to growth of renewable energy and the reduction in greenhouse gas emissions. Distribution transformers are used in the electrical distribution system, ensuring electrical power is delivered safely, efficiently, and reliably to homes, businesses, and industries. Also, Energy-efficient transformers are designed to minimize energy losses used in transmission and distribution of electrical power. Solar transformers are critical components in transmission of solar energy systems in compatibility in residential, commercial, industrial, and utility-scale applications. Furnace Transformers are specialized devices for conversion of electrical power between different voltage levels. Oil Cooled Transformers are designed in housed inside metallic tanks to withstand full vacuum during processing of concentrated point loads of lifting, hauling, jacking etc.

The Company launched its IPO of 71,80,000 equity shares of Rs 10 by raising a fresh issue of 46.67 crores on 26 December 2023.

SPEL focused on larger power transformers in 2024. It Achieved vendor approval from the Kerala State Electricity Board (KSEB) a milestone that enhances SPEL's eligibility to participate in state-level tenders and strengthens its presence in southern India in 2025.

The Company announced a major Rs.21.30 Cr order from a Chennai-based electric company for the supply of 57 high-capacity oil-cooled distribution transformers, including: 36 units of 1600 KVA, 19 units of 2000 KVA and 2 units of 2500 KVA in January, 2025. It secured a Rs.10.18 Cr order from a Chennai-based firm for the supply of transformer components in February 2025.
